Factors That Influence Tarnishing of Stainless Steel Jewelry
Stainless steel jewelry is often praised for its resistance to tarnishing, but certain environmental and care-related factors can influence its appearance over time. Understanding these factors helps in maintaining the jewelry’s luster and avoiding unwanted discoloration.
One primary factor is the alloy composition. Stainless steel used in jewelry typically contains varying amounts of chromium, nickel, and other metals. Chromium forms a passive oxide layer that protects the metal from corrosion and tarnishing. However, if this layer is compromised, the jewelry may develop spots or discoloration.
Exposure to moisture and chemicals also plays a significant role. Frequent contact with water, sweat, lotions, perfumes, and cleaning agents can degrade the protective surface, leading to dullness or minor tarnishing. Chlorine, in particular, found in swimming pools or cleaning products, is known to accelerate corrosion in stainless steel.
Physical abrasion can wear down the surface coating, especially in lower-grade stainless steel alloys. Scratches and dents disrupt the oxide layer, making the underlying metal more susceptible to oxidation.
Humidity and air quality impact the rate of tarnishing as well. Environments with high humidity or pollutants can increase the likelihood of surface changes.

Comparing Tarnish Resistance Among Different Stainless Steel Grades
Not all stainless steel is created equal when it comes to jewelry. Various grades exhibit different levels of corrosion resistance and durability, affecting their tendency to tarnish. The most common grades used in jewelry are 304, 316L, and 430 stainless steel.
Grade | Composition Highlights | Tarnish Resistance | Common Uses in Jewelry |
---|---|---|---|
304 | 18% Cr, 8% Ni | Good resistance; prone to surface oxidation if exposed to harsh chemicals | Fashion jewelry, general-purpose pieces |
316L | 16-18% Cr, 10-14% Ni, 2-3% Mo | Excellent resistance due to molybdenum content; highly durable | High-end jewelry, body jewelry, medical-grade pieces |
430 | 16-18% Cr, low Ni | Moderate resistance; more prone to tarnishing and corrosion | Lower-cost jewelry, decorative items |
316L stainless steel is favored for its superior corrosion resistance, especially in environments prone to moisture and sweat. It is hypoallergenic and less likely to tarnish, making it ideal for long-term wear.
Grades like 430 are more susceptible to rust and discoloration when exposed to moisture or chemicals, and thus require more careful maintenance.
Care Tips to Prevent Tarnishing of Stainless Steel Jewelry
Proper care is essential to maintain the appearance and longevity of stainless steel jewelry. Adhering to the following best practices can significantly reduce the risk of tarnishing:
- Avoid prolonged exposure to moisture: Remove jewelry before swimming, bathing, or engaging in activities that cause excessive sweating.
- Keep away from harsh chemicals: Perfumes, lotions, and household cleaners can degrade the protective oxide layer. Apply cosmetics before putting on jewelry and avoid contact with cleaning agents.
- Clean regularly with gentle methods: Use a soft cloth or mild soap and warm water to clean jewelry. Avoid abrasive materials that can scratch the surface.
- Store properly: Keep pieces in a dry, air-tight container or jewelry box with anti-tarnish strips to minimize exposure to humidity and pollutants.
- Handle with care: Avoid dropping or banging jewelry against hard surfaces to prevent scratches and dents.

Understanding Tarnish and Its Effects on Stainless Steel Jewelry
Tarnish refers to the surface discoloration or dulling that occurs when certain metals react chemically with elements in their environment, such as oxygen, sulfur compounds, or moisture. This reaction often results in a thin layer of corrosion, which can alter the appearance of jewelry.
In stainless steel jewelry, tarnishing is significantly less common compared to other metals like silver or copper due to its unique alloy composition and protective properties.
- Composition of Stainless Steel: Typically composed of iron, chromium, nickel, and other elements, stainless steel contains at least 10.5% chromium. This chromium forms a passive oxide layer on the surface, which acts as a barrier against corrosion and tarnish.
- Protective Oxide Layer: The chromium oxide film is self-healing; if scratched or damaged, it quickly reforms, maintaining the jewelry’s resistance to tarnish and corrosion.
- Environmental Factors: Exposure to harsh chemicals, saltwater, or abrasive substances can degrade this protective layer, potentially causing discoloration or dullness over time.
Metal Type | Tarnish Likelihood | Primary Tarnish Cause | Resistance Mechanism |
---|---|---|---|
Stainless Steel | Low | Rare surface oxidation | Chromium oxide passive layer |
Silver | High | Reaction with sulfur compounds | None; requires polishing |
Copper | High | Oxidation and sulfur exposure | None; develops patina |
Factors That Can Cause Stainless Steel Jewelry to Tarnish or Discolor
Although stainless steel is highly resistant to tarnish, certain conditions can compromise its appearance:
- Exposure to Chlorides: Saltwater or chlorine in swimming pools can corrode stainless steel over prolonged exposure, especially lower-grade alloys.
- Harsh Chemicals: Contact with strong acids, bleach, or cleaning agents may damage the protective oxide layer and lead to discoloration.
- Physical Damage: Scratches or abrasion can temporarily remove the oxide layer, making the metal vulnerable until the layer reforms.
- Low-Quality Alloy: Some stainless steel jewelry uses lower-quality or mixed alloys lacking sufficient chromium content, reducing corrosion resistance.
- Improper Storage: Keeping jewelry in damp or high-humidity environments without ventilation can promote surface oxidation.

Marcus Lee (Jewelry Designer and Materials Specialist). From a design and materials standpoint, stainless steel is favored for its durability and resistance to corrosion. Unlike softer metals, it does not react easily with air or moisture, which prevents tarnish formation. However, impurities or low-grade alloys labeled as stainless steel may show signs of discoloration, so consumers should seek reputable sources for authentic stainless steel jewelry.
Dr. Priya Nair (Chemical Engineer, Corrosion Research Laboratory). Tarnishing is primarily a surface oxidation process, and stainless steel’s unique composition inhibits this reaction. The chromium in the alloy creates a self-healing passive film that protects the metal underneath. While stainless steel jewelry can develop surface stains or dullness due to environmental factors, these are not true tarnish and can be removed with appropriate cleaning methods.
